My name is Heather St.George.I want to tell you about my first experience with a pit bull.I was homeless at the age of 17 yrs old.I used to walk the streets of Akron,Ohio.One day, I walked by a house and saw a man beating his pit bull with a chain.After seeing that, I asked the owner if I could have her.He told me that he was going to kill her any way and that I could do what I wanted with her.She was a pure white red nose with a scar around her back leg where a chain had been wrapped around and yanked back.Her name was Nala.For the first two weeks,I couldn't walk down the street without her trying to bite everyone.She was very protective of me.She finally realized that not everyone is out to hurt me. She never left my side,even with out the leash.I finally came to the realization that I could not care for her the way that she deserved to be cared for.All I could do was give her all of my love.One day, I tried to let Nala loose in the woods.I knew she loved the woods and hoped that someone would give her the care she deserved.But she wouldn't leave my side.Finally, a friend seen me walking and picked me up.Nala chased the car for about 2 miles.I broke down in tears.That is when I realized that we had a special bond.I let her in the car and my friend offered to take her to his house and keep her there so that I could come see her.I found out 2 days later that his parents took her to the humane society, where she was put to sleep because she had no tag or insurance on her.In Ohio, you have to have insurance to own a pit bull.I always think of her and the bond that we had together.After having her, I know that with the right training and lots of love, the American Pit Bull Terrier is one of the best companion dogs out there.They are very loving and devoted.I know that there are a lot of Nala's out there waiting to find love.
